Войти
Регистрация
Спроси ai-bota
В
Все
У
Українська література
Г
Геометрия
Д
Другие предметы
Э
Экономика
Г
География
О
ОБЖ
М
Математика
М
МХК
Х
Химия
Қ
Қазақ тiлi
Л
Литература
У
Українська мова
О
Обществознание
Ф
Физика
А
Английский язык
А
Алгебра
И
История
Б
Беларуская мова
Б
Биология
М
Музыка
П
Право
И
Информатика
П
Психология
В
Видео-ответы
Н
Немецкий язык
Ф
Французский язык
О
Окружающий мир
Р
Русский язык
Показать больше
Показать меньше
NastyaANIME
25.03.2023 05:03 •
Информатика
C++.дана матрица с(6,6). определить количество "особых" элементов массива, считая элемент "особым", если он больше суммы остальных элементов своего столбца. напечатать индексы "особых" элементов.
Ответ:
марленна
21.08.2020 11:26
#include <iostream>
#include <cstdlib>
#include <iomanip>
using namespace std;
int const n=6;
int const m=6;
int main() {
int a[n][m];
int sm;
// установка генератора случайных чисел
srand(time(NULL));
// генерация массива и вывод на экран
for (int i=0; i<n; i++) {
for (int j=0; j<m; j++) {
a[i][j]=rand()%50-20;
cout<<setw(7)<<a[i][j];
}
cout<<endl;
}
// обработка массива
for (int i=0; i<m; i++) {
sm=0;
for (int j=0; j<n; j++) sm+=a[j][i];
for (int j=0; j<n; j++)
if (2*a[j][i]>sm) cout<<j+1<<" "<<i+1<<endl;
}
system("pause");
return 0;
}
-16 -2 15 4 7 3
-13 16 3 16 -13 3
0 19 20 6 20 -18
-19 7 1 10 -11 25
5 4 3 21 28 -13
26 -19 -7 12 -20 11
1 1
2 1
3 1
5 1
6 1
3 5
5 5
4 6
0,0
(0 оценок)
Популярные вопросы: Информатика
упс121
19.04.2022 12:44
Выбери верные ответы. «Бумажная» технология — 1. Нет верного ответа 2. Минимальные материальные затраты на авторучку и лист бумаги. 3. Удобство редактирования. 4.Трудоёмкость уничтожения...
valia01022004
17.01.2022 17:23
Он обуславливает первую стадию загрузки компьютера, проводит проверку и запускает операционную систему...
жееннняяя
03.08.2020 02:11
Найти ошибку в коде, не верно сортирует: нужно четные эл-ты отсортировать по возрастанию,а нечетные по убыванию си++ я уже все перепроверила никак не получается найти { srand(time(0));...
алалайла
10.10.2020 22:50
Укажи общий признак рыб a) на людей b) обитают в водоёме c) питаются водорослями d) красного цвета...
Mmilanio
27.01.2020 17:57
Как в памяти компьтера представляются целые положительные и отрицательные числа?...
Vlaad555
24.04.2022 07:07
Как сохранить в мобильной школе образования? не могу сохранить...
Ученик132312
24.04.2022 07:07
Как записать программу в vba которой в блоке ввода данных будет вводиться фамилия и имя , а блоке вывода фраза фамилия имя . где вместо фамилии и имени введение данные....
kh131
24.04.2022 07:07
Как создать программу в vba которой в блоке ввода данных будет вводиться фамилия и имя , а в блоке вывода фраза , фамилия имя . где вместо фамилии и имя введенные данные ....
Малышкалюбитспать
24.04.2022 07:07
Для игры хотят разделиться на команды так, чтобы у любого все его друзья были с ним в команде. на какое наибольшее количество команд смогут разделиться? ниже информация о том, кто...
ARproVL
10.02.2020 16:23
Почему в графическом редакторе paint нет команды группировки ?...
Полный доступ
Позволит учиться лучше и быстрее. Неограниченный доступ к базе и ответам от экспертов и ai-bota
Оформи подписку
О НАС
О нас
Блог
Карьера
Условия пользования
Авторское право
Политика конфиденциальности
Политика использования файлов cookie
Предпочтения cookie-файлов
СООБЩЕСТВО
Сообщество
Для школ
Родителям
Кодекс чести
Правила сообщества
Insights
Стань помощником
ПОМОЩЬ
Зарегистрируйся
Центр помощи
Центр безопасности
Договор о конфиденциальности полученной информации
App
Начни делиться знаниями
Вход
Регистрация
Что ты хочешь узнать?
#include <cstdlib>
#include <iomanip>
using namespace std;
int const n=6;
int const m=6;
int main() {
int a[n][m];
int sm;
// установка генератора случайных чисел
srand(time(NULL));
// генерация массива и вывод на экран
for (int i=0; i<n; i++) {
for (int j=0; j<m; j++) {
a[i][j]=rand()%50-20;
cout<<setw(7)<<a[i][j];
}
cout<<endl;
}
// обработка массива
for (int i=0; i<m; i++) {
sm=0;
for (int j=0; j<n; j++) sm+=a[j][i];
for (int j=0; j<n; j++)
if (2*a[j][i]>sm) cout<<j+1<<" "<<i+1<<endl;
}
system("pause");
return 0;
}
-16 -2 15 4 7 3
-13 16 3 16 -13 3
0 19 20 6 20 -18
-19 7 1 10 -11 25
5 4 3 21 28 -13
26 -19 -7 12 -20 11
1 1
2 1
3 1
5 1
6 1
3 5
5 5
4 6